org.jboss.mx.persistence
Interface PersistenceManager

All Known Implementing Classes:
DelegatingPersistenceManager (src) , MbeanInfoDbPm (src) , NullPersistence (src) , ObjectStreamPersistenceManager (src) , XMLFilePersistenceManager (src)

public interface PersistenceManager

Persistence manager interface adds MBeanInfo to PersistenMBean operations. This allows generic persistence manager implementations to store and load the metadata of an MBean.

See Also:
PersistentMBean (src)

Method Summary
 void load(ModelMBeanInvoker (src)  mbean, MBeanInfo (src)  metadata)
           
 void store(MBeanInfo (src)  metadata)
           
 

Method Detail

load

public void load(ModelMBeanInvoker (src)  mbean,
                 MBeanInfo (src)  metadata)
          throws MBeanException (src) 
Throws:
MBeanException (src)

store

public void store(MBeanInfo (src)  metadata)
           throws MBeanException (src) 
Throws:
MBeanException (src)